Georgia Headlines - 11/6/09
1. Georgia's defense has managed to collect just six takeaways this year... the lowest total of all 120 FBS schools.
2. The Bulldogs' strength and conditioning coach is hot over TV analyst Randy Cross' decision to say Georgia players look "weak." Indeed, Dave Van Halanger has been in Athens since 2001 and no one has complained about their strength until now.
3. Mark Richt says Georgia works hard to keep up to date on the latest strength and conditioning techniques.
4. Richt is happy to be back between the hedges this week...
5. But that doesn't mean he'll see a full house of happy faces for UGA's homecoming game with Tennessee Tech.
6. In basketball news, the Mark Fox era tips off tonight in an exhibition game against North Georgia.
